Matthew Lloyd is a Mechanical Engineer with the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ers’ Hydroelectric Design Center (HDC), specializing in hydroelectric turbomachinery. His work supports the design, rehabilitation, and maintenance of turbines and related equipment at federal hydropower facilities through design reviews, technical specifications, inspections, quality assurance, and multidisciplinary coordination.

Before joining USACE, Matthew worked as an aircraft mechanic, gaining hands-on experience with mechanical, hydraulic, and electrical systems. That background continues to inform his practical approach to engineering and his interest in connecting design decisions with fabrication, installation, operation, and maintenance.
